Management Commentary
During the accompanying official earnings call, Precigen leadership addressed both the the previous quarter financial results and recent operational milestones. Management noted that the reported revenue for the quarter came primarily from existing strategic partnership agreements and limited legacy product sales, with no new major partnership deals closed during the period. The leadership team also highlighted cost optimization efforts rolled out over the course of the quarter that helped reduce non-R&D operating expenses, partially offsetting ongoing investment in its lead pipeline candidates. Management emphasized that the negative EPS for the previous quarter is consistent with its near-term strategy of prioritizing clinical trial enrollment and data collection for its most advanced therapy candidates, which are targeted at indications with high unmet medical need. All remarks shared during the call aligned with public disclosures, with no unsubstantiated claims made about future operational outcomes.

Forward Guidance
PGEN’s leadership provided qualitative forward guidance during the call, avoiding specific quantitative projections for future periods in line with its standard disclosure practice for clinical-stage biotech operations. Management noted that the company will continue to prioritize advancing its lead pipeline candidates through clinical development in the upcoming months, with potential interim data readouts for two of its most advanced programs possibly arriving in the near term. The leadership team also stated that operating expenses may remain at similar levels in the coming periods as R&D activities continue, though cost control initiatives are expected to help mitigate unnecessary spending wherever possible. Management added that the company’s current cash position is expected to be sufficient to fund planned operations for the foreseeable future, eliminating immediate risk of dilutive financing for the time being, based on their public assessment.

Market Reaction
Following the release of the previous quarter earnings, trading activity for PGEN shares saw slightly above-average volume in the first two sessions after the announcement, with mixed price movement reflecting differing investor assessments of the results. Sell-side analysts covering Precigen have published updated notes following the release, with most focusing more heavily on pipeline progress updates than the quarterly financial results, as is typical for clinical-stage biotech firms where long-term value is tied closely to regulatory and clinical success rather than near-term revenue. Many analysts noted that the reported EPS and revenue figures were largely in line with broad market expectations, leading to relatively muted overall market reaction in the week following the release. Broader biotech sector sentiment in recent weeks, which has been influenced by regulatory updates for gene therapy candidates across the industry, may also be contributing to PGEN’s share price movement alongside the earnings news.
